Denise 10Here at Ozarks Food Harvest, we rely on monthly supporters to help us provide over 15 million meals each year to our neighbors who are struggling to make ends meet.

This is why we created Harvest Circle, a special community of our dedicated donors who make monthly gifts to provide a steady stream of funds for The Food Bank.

Becoming a member of Harvest Circle is beneficial for donors and The Food Bank. One reason is for the sake of effectiveness. Your monthly commitment helps us plan ahead, budget efficiently and respond to needs.

By becoming a monthly donor, your commitment gives us assurance that we will have a steady stream of donations to help meet the growing need in our community. Your gifts will make an impact and allow us to serve more people struggling with hunger.

April, a 16-year-old, said, “We’re always short of money and sometimes we run out of food. My mom is bedridden, and my dad had to have back surgery and now he might need another surgery. If we didn’t get this food, it would be so hard.”

It’s our hope that encouraging donors to join Harvest Circle will help even more families like April’s. By making a monthly contribution of $50, you would provide a family of four with breakfast and dinner, plus after-school snacks for two children throughout the year.
